Re: Omo Shasha Oluwa Forest Reserve (Pictures) by Thatitan234(m): 7:29pm On Jan 12, 2016
Hmmm this same forest reserve that I was for 10 weeks last year??

Its not a place just anyone can go and have fun oo.

the place is underfunded and almost dead sef. Only destructive logging activities is what's left happening there.

No network, water and electricity again. Even the guest house is left unused

The bamboo groove, water fall and fish lake nko?? all out of it

Bad road and every other infrastructure is spoilt and unreplaced.

Only that bailey bridge crossing over the Omo river is still existing. It leads to the Elephants camp.

However, I enjoyed myself there but trust me you gotta be a forester or environmentalist to persevere and appreciate whats left of the place.

The place remains a natural resources reserve.

Re: Omo Shasha Oluwa Forest Reserve (Pictures) by AreaFada2: 7:48pm On Jan 12, 2016
Mzgracie:
Like seriously, I can't believe what my eyes are seeing..
Never knew something like still exist in Naija

You're right. There are many.
See also Okomu National Park in Edo. Okomu Oil traded on NSE is from same area.
Though smaller than this, has 150 bird species and many endangered species of fauna & Flora. Already gazetted by colonial government in 1935!

They have chalets for guests & tourists to rent. Very nice.
